Explain the structure of Intermediate Filaments?
Intermediate filaments, about 8 to 10 nm in diameter, are so named because they are intermediate in size between microfilaments and microtubules. These medium-sized filaments serve along with microtubules and microfilaments to form the cytoskeleton or framework of the cell. Intermediate filaments help to maintain the position of the nucleus in the center of the cell. They are the most stable of the intracellular filaments, and they are composed of fibrous proteins similar to those that make up hair and skin.
